Serving 655 students in grades Prekindergarten-6, Rice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Arizona for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 6% (which is lower than the Arizona state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 3% (which is lower than the Arizona state average of 40%).
The student-teacher ratio of 12:1 is lower than the Arizona state level of 17:1.

Rice Elementary School's student population of 655 students has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
The teacher population of 54 teachers has grown by 8% over five school years.

Rice Elementary School ranks within the bottom 50% of all 1,921 schools in Arizona (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Rice Elementary School is 0.02,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.66.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
